## Deploying the Gatewick Proctor Queue

Deploys are pretty painless: push to main, wait for the pipeline, then watch the queue drain dashboard for five minutes. If candidates pile up mid-exam, roll back first and ask questions later — the queue replays safely. Everything the workers care about lives in one config block, shown here for reference.

settings of bafof-yagef:
JOROX_PIN=8740
JOROX_TENANT=pelox
JOROX_METRICS_HOST=metrics.jorox.qorvelworks.internal
JOROX_SEAL=seal_c78f63c1
JOROX_STANDBY_TEAM=norax

- [ ] **Rotate the Thistlebrook cache keys.** Before we sign the new release, the tax-rate lookup cache on Grayport needs fresh encryption keys — yes, even though it's "just" cached public rates, policy says so. Flush the cache after rotation or you'll serve entries signed with the old key. When the ceremony tool asks for authorization, give it the recovery passphrase printed below.

vault phrase of tajeg-tageg = pelix-druix-holius-briael-zorwyn-frawyn-fraox-norok-drueth-aldiel

Briefing — Leadership Review: Partner Term Sheet

For branch managers ahead of Thursday's review: Ostrand Logistics has tabled a term sheet proposing a three-year distribution arrangement covering the Halbury corridor. Key points are volume commitments with a minimum annual floor, shared warehousing costs, and an exclusivity clause limited to the Ferren product line. Legal has flagged the termination terms for renegotiation. Managers should prepare capacity estimates for their regions. A confidential note on our position follows directly below.

confidential, kajof-tahof: The pricing group signed off on a budget of $491.8 million for Project Casvan.

Leadership Review Briefing — Finance Team, Orvella Systems

The proposed Meridian Plus subscription tier is ready for review. Pricing lands between our Core and Enterprise offerings, targeting mid-size accounts that have outgrown Core. Modeling by Dario's group projects breakeven within five quarters, assuming a 9% conversion rate from existing Core subscribers. Launch would follow the Bramford pilot results in early spring. Detailed assumptions are attached for the session.

board note of fafog-yahap: Project Rusdor slips by a full year because of the audit delay.